VP Radhakrishnan to release Mission Rangeen Machhli 2031

Vice President CP Radhakrishnan will release the "Mission Rangeen Machhli 2031" Strategic Action Plan for Ornamental Fisheries Development at an outreach programme organised by the Department of Fisheries, Ministry of Fisheries, Animal Husbandry & Dairying, in Agatti, Lakshadweep, on August 31. The event marks a significant push toward organised growth of India's ornamental fisheries sector.
The Strategic Action Plan aims to bring a uniform, science-based framework to the ornamental fisheries value chain across the country. It focuses on scientific management, biosecurity, quality assurance, and regulatory compliance, ensuring the sector grows in a structured and sustainable manner rather than remaining fragmented, as it largely is today.
The outreach programme will see participation from several key figures, including Union Minister for Fisheries, Animal Husbandry & Dairying and Panchayati Raj, Rajiv Ranjan Singh, and Minister of State Prof. SP Singh Baghel. Lakshadweep Administrator Praful Khode Patel will also be present. Beyond officials, the event will bring together fish farmers and fishers, including a notable presence of women fish farmers, along with representatives from fisheries clusters, line ministries, and departments from both the central and Lakshadweep governments.
India holds enormous untapped marine potential, with a coastline stretching about 11,099 km and an Exclusive Economic Zone covering roughly 2.2 million sq. km. The country's marine fisheries potential is estimated at over 5 million tonnes, offering major scope for deep-sea fishing, mariculture, and blue economy expansion. Lakshadweep alone contributes nearly 17% of India's total EEZ, spread across almost 4 lakh sq. km, along with a lagoon area exceeding 4,200 sq. km, making it one of the most resource-rich marine zones in the country.
The government has adopted a cluster-based model to encourage integrated, value-chain-driven growth in fisheries. Under this approach, Lakshadweep has been officially designated as a Seaweed Cluster, promoting cultivation, processing, and market linkages for seaweed products. The islands also hold rich ornamental fisheries resources, opening avenues for sustainable rearing, exports, and local livelihoods while keeping marine ecosystems protected.
As part of the outreach event, the Vice President will also distribute benefits directly to fisheries sector beneficiaries, recognising the contribution of fishing communities and encouraging wider participation in sustainable fisheries practices.
The Standard Operating Procedures under the new plan will bring consistency to broodstock management, breeding, hatchery operations, quarantine protocols, health management, and traceability. They will also cover aquarium operations, handling, transport, and trade, helping strengthen stakeholder capabilities, improve product quality, and support certification for better market access both within India and internationally.
